Over the past couple of years, I have included a lesson in my App Inventor 2 Unit that covers Google Fusion Tables. Later in the year, the students learn how to work with SQL directly, but using Google Fusion tables is a nice way to introduce them to how to query/add/update an online database while building an app at the same time. I have each student complete and expand upon the App Inventor 2 pizza party app, which, uses Fusion Tables to keep track of customer orders.
I received an email from Google yesterday that Fusion Tables will be decommissioned during 2019. Can anyone recommend an alternative that doesn't require running an SQL database off of a separate server? Fusion Tables were nice because after setting up the service account, the students could get right to work because the table was hosted by Google.
